Description

The high-energy and short-distances regime of the strong interaction is successfully described by Quantum Chromodynamics (QCD) involving quark and gluon degrees of freedom. In the low-energy and large-distances regime, QCD-inspired effective models are needed to describe the observed phenomena. These models predict a modification of the properties of hadrons in nuclear matter from their free-space values. A review of the theoretical and experimental approach to the in-medium modifications of light hadrons will be given.
